Beyond Religion: Ethics, Values & Well-Being FULL VERSION
Sunday, October 14, 2012 Video courtesy of: The Center at MIT How can we move beyond narrow religious perspectives and polarized issues to a more embracing view of human responsibilities and values? This is a talk by His Holiness the Dalai Lama, followed by discussion with Brother David Steindl-Rast and Father Thomas Keating: an historic meeting of three elders, moral authorities of world standing, together envisioning a nonsectarian ethics of human well-being.
